When you're picking out a 100 amp breaker, there's actually quite a few things you wanna keep in mind to make sure everything works smoothly and safely. First off, the type of breaker matters a lot—whether it’s a standard one, GFCI (that’s Ground Fault Circuit Interrupter), or AFCI (Arc Fault Circuit Interrupter). Each of these has its own role. For example, GFCI breakers are awesome for wet areas like bathrooms or outdoor spots because they protect against shocks. On the other hand, AFCIs are key for preventing electrical fires caused by arc faults. Getting a handle on these differences helps you pick what's best for your setup without any headaches.

: A 100 amp breaker is a critical electrical component that protects circuits from overloads and short circuits by interrupting the flow of electricity when hazardous conditions are detected.
It ensures the safety and reliability of electrical installations by preventing damage to wiring and connected devices, especially in homes and buildings with higher electrical demands.
The three common types of 100 amp breakers are standard breakers, GFCI (Ground Fault Circuit Interrupter) breakers for wet locations, and AFCI (Arc Fault Circuit Interrupter) breakers that prevent electrical fires.
A GFCI breaker provides protection against electrical shock by interrupting the electrical flow in wet locations where it is installed.
The trip curve determines how quickly a breaker responds to overloads or short circuits; fast-acting breakers are better for sensitive electronics, while slower-acting breakers can handle temporary surges without tripping.
Consider the type of breaker required, the trip curve, brand reliability, and warranty offerings to ensure safety and efficiency in your electrical system.
Yes, selecting the right brand and type of breaker can influence both the safety of your system and its longevity.
A 100 amp breaker is typically used in residential or commercial settings where there is a need to support multiple appliances or higher electrical demand simultaneously.
Not using an appropriate breaker can lead to circuit overloads, potential electrical fires, damage to wiring and appliances, and increased risks of electrical shocks.
